首页 > 数据库 >redis集群的搭建

redis集群的搭建

时间:2024-09-14 11:02:11浏览次数:8  
标签:redis server cluster 集群 conf 7000 搭建

一、创建节点文件夹
因为集群至少要6个节点,所有创建6个文件夹
mkdir 700{0,1,2,3,4,5}

二、复制配置文件到每个创建的文件夹
cp redis.conf 700{0,1,2,3,4,5}

三、修改每个配置文件的端口等信息

绑定服务器的 IP:bind 0.0.0.0 或者注释掉 # bind 0.0.0.0
关闭保护模式 用于公网访问:protectec-mode no
绑定端口号对应文件夹的名称:port 7000
启用集群:cluster-enabled yes

配置每个节点点的配置文件,同样端口号为文件名:cluster-config-file /mytool/redis_cluster/7008/nodes-7配置集群节点的超时时间,可以不改变:cluster-node-timeout 5000
后台启动:daemonize yes
修改pid 进程文件名,以端口号命名:pidfile /var/run/redis-7000.pid修改日志文件名,用端口号来区分:1ogfile"./7000/redis-7000.log"修改数据文件存放的地址,以端口号为目录来区分:dir /mytool/redis_cluster/7000/连接密码:requirepass 123
集群连接密码与上保持一致:masterauth123

启用AOF来增强持久化策略:appendonlyyes

四、启动所有节点
./redis-server 7000/redis.conf
./redis-server 7001/redis.conf
./redis-server 7002/redis.conf
./redis-server 7003/redis.conf
./redis-server 7004/redis.conf
./redis-server 7005/redis.conf

五、创建集群
./redis-cli --cluster create -a lad2012- 127.0.0.1:7000 127.0.0.1:7001 127.0.0.1:7002 127.0.0.1:7003 127.0.0.1:7004 127.0.0.1:7005 --cluster-replicas 1

等待redis自动创建集群

六、连接集群
加-c就是代表cluster的意思
./redis-cli -c -p 7000

查看集群信息

七、停止集群

标签:redis,server,cluster,集群,conf,7000,搭建
From: https://www.cnblogs.com/velloLei/p/18413501

相关文章

  • kafka集群架构设计原理详解
    目录从Zookeeper数据理解Kafka集群工作机制Kafka的Zookeeper元数据梳理1、zookeeper整体数据2、ControllerBroker选举机制3、LeaderPartition选举机制4、LeaderPartition自动平衡机制5、Partition故障恢复机制6、HW一致性保障-Epoch更新机制7、总结从Zookeeper......
  • 第三十二节 kubeadm部署k8s 1.28.x高可用集群
    底层走docker底层走containerd容器操作系统:openEuler-24.03主机名:cat/etc/hosts主机3台192.168.80.54lyc-80-54master192.168.80.55lyc-80-55master192.168.80.56lyc-80-56master192.168.80.56lyc-80-57worker192.168.80.56lyc-80-58worker系统关闭selin......
  • 如何搭建短视频平台,微服务架构为系统性能加成
    如何搭建短视频平台,微服务架构为系统性能加成什么是微服务?微服务是一种架构风格,其中单体应用被划分为若干个小型、松散耦合且独立的服务。所有这些微服务共同工作,形成一个更大的系统。在微服务架构中,每个服务代表一个特定的业务能力,并作为一个拥有自己的数据库和逻辑的独立......
  • Mysql 搭建主从复制
    DockerMysql镜像启动命令(主库)dockerrun--namemysql-master -ti-d--privileged="true" -p3306:3306alibaba-cloud-linux-3-registry.cn-hangzhou.cr.aliyuncs.com/alinux3/mysql_optimized:20240221-8.0.32-2.3.0mysql_keentune.sh 修改临时密码如......
  • 从0开始计算机体系结构的学习(一):FGPA预备知识与Vivado环境搭建
    引入与预备知识什么是FPGA?FPGA(Field-ProgrammableGateArray,现场可编程门阵列)是一种集成电路(IC),其硬件功能可以通过用户在现场编程来定义。与传统的ASIC(专用集成电路)不同,FPGA在制造完成后仍然可以根据需求进行重新配置。因此,它们被广泛应用于需要灵活性和可定制性且性能要求较高......
  • Redis 分布式锁的正确实现原理演化历程与 Redission的源码
    ......
  • 从零开始一步一步搭建 Vue3 + Webpack5 项目脚手架指南
    **......
  • 8、【实战中提升自己】华为 华三中小型企业网络架构搭建 【无线架构之三层漫游】
     1 拓扑与说明         某公司的网络架构,这样的架构在目前的网络中是在常见的,假设您接收一个这样的网络,应该如何部署,该实战系列,就是一步一步讲解,如何规划、设计、部署这样一个环境,这里会针对不同的情况给出不同的讲解,比如拓扑中有2个ISP,假设客户需求是,想实现主备的......
  • 搭建Jellyfin、Plex、Emby媒体服务,贝锐花生壳轻松内网穿透远程访问
    很多使用品牌NAS或自建NAS的小伙伴都有媒体库的需求,其中Jellyfin、Plex和Emby是三款流行的媒体服务方案。以Jellyfin为例,系统允许用户组织、串流和管理他们的多媒体藏品,包括视频、音乐和图片。由于,很多品牌NAS比如,群晖、威联通、铁威马等,以及TrueNAS、UnRaid等NAS系统,都已经集成了......
  • 搭建网站流量提升,SEO代运营公司有哪些?
    搭建网站流量提升,SEO代运营公司有哪些?专业网络推广公司,专为企业提供短视频营销、短视频运营、短视频推广等策划和方案,等你来了解#网络推广#网络推广公司#短视频推广#短视频运营#短视频营销推荐阅读:网站建设代运营公司网站搭建(网站建设代运营推广公司)https://www.bsw8......